How they compare
Brazil currently reports 688.27 million TDS, current US$ against 534.35 million TDS, current US$ in Angola, a difference of 153.92 million TDS, current US$.
That makes Brazil's figure about 1.3 times Angola's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 26 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Brazil ahead.
Globally, Angola ranks 16th and Brazil ranks 13th of 122 countries.

About this data
IMF repurchases are total repayments of outstanding drawings from the General Resources Account during the year specified, excluding repayments due in the reserve tranche. IMF charges cover interest payments with respect to all uses of IMF resources, excluding those resulting from drawings in the reserve tranche.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
